About Özlem Yönem

Özlem Yönem is a scholar working on Surgery, Epidemiology, Molecular Biology, Hepatology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 44 papers that have together received 580 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Helicobacter pylori-related gastroenterology studies (7 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(7 papers), Pediatric Hepatobiliary Diseases and Treatments (6 papers), Inflammatory Biomarkers in Disease Prognosis (5 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(5 papers), Congenital Anomalies and Fetal Surgery (4 papers), Inflammasome and immune disorders (4 papers) and Eosinophilic Esophagitis (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(87 citations), Hepatology (58 citations), Surgery (264 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(95 citations) and Genetics (158 citations). Özlem Yönem has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Hatice Sebila Dökmetaş, Cansel Türkay, Serdal Korkmaz, Yusuf Bayraktar, İşılay Nadir, Osman Ersoy, Taner Erselcan, Süleyman Aslan, Cenk Sökmensüer and Özgür Harmancı. Their work appears in journals such as World Journal of Gastroenterology, Renal Failure, Digestive Diseases and Sciences, Journal of the National Medical Association and Endocrine Research.
